Job Description
A client in the retail/CPG space is seeking a high-level AI Solutions & Data Architecture Lead to support the evaluation, implementation, and optimization of enterprise AI, data, and security solutions within our Data & Analytics (DNA) environment. This role will focus on guiding AI strategy across analytics, automation, and security—leveraging off-the-shelf solutions and working cross-functionally with architecture, security, and data teams.
This is a non-coding, strategic role focused on vendor evaluation, implementation oversight, and aligning AI capabilities to business outcomes. This will be 100% remote and will be a contract-hire position.

Required Skills & Experience
Experience leading or advising on enterprise AI strategy and implementation
Strong understanding of AI applications across:
Analytics
Automation (RPA/process optimization)
Security & data protection
Familiarity with modern data ecosystems, including cloud platforms (Azure preferred) and data tools (Databricks, BI tools)
Experience working with off-the-shelf AI/security platforms and vendor evaluation
Knowledge of data governance, compliance, and security frameworks (e.g., SOX, data privacy standards)
Ability to operate at a high-level (strategic/architectural) without hands-on coding
Experience with data masking/tokenization tools (e.g., Skyflow or similar)
Exposure to LLMs and AI model ecosystems (Azure AI, Claude, etc.)
Background in building or advising on AI-enabled data architectures
Nice to Have Skills & Experience
Experience in Retail or CPG environments
